🌤 Seasonal Tip: Beat the Heat, Dodge the Rain, Savor the Day

Summer in ENC is all about making the most of those sunny mornings before the heat sets in—and finding the best ways to stay cool when afternoon storms roll through. Here's how to enjoy the day no matter what the weather has in store:

Start Your Day with a Quick Outdoor Adventure

Rise and shine! Before the humidity kicks in, take advantage of the cooler early hours for a brisk walk or bike ride. Head to places like Town Common, River Park North, or the Green Mill Run Greenway—where you’ll enjoy nature and a refreshing breeze. A quick dose of the outdoors will leave you feeling energized, and it’s a perfect way to beat the heat before midday.

Cool Off with a Local Frozen Treat

When the temperature rises, treat yourself to something sweet and frosty. Whether you’re in the mood for frozen yogurt, Italian ice, or a cold brew, Greenville has plenty of budget-friendly spots to chill out. Try Simply Natural Creamery or a refreshing iced coffee from Blackbeard Coffee. With these treats starting around $5, you can beat the heat without breaking the bank.

Rainy Day? Embrace the Culture Indoors

Don’t let the storms stop your fun! If the clouds roll in, pop into one of our local cultural gems, like the ECU Wellington B. Gray Gallery or Emerge Gallery. These air-conditioned spots offer a peaceful escape, and with free admission at places like the Greenville Museum of Art, you can soak up some local culture without spending a dime. It’s the perfect way to relax and stay dry on a rainy afternoon.

Date Idea: Board Games & Coffee

Where: Well Played Games (1400 Charles Blvd, Greenville, NC)
Cost: $20 per person

Skip the usual dinner-and-a-movie and opt for a more playful kind of date night. At Well Played, you can sip craft lattes or local beer while choosing from hundreds of board games—from cozy two-player options to strategy showdowns. The cozy vibe and shelves full of games make it easy to laugh, compete, or simply unwind together.
Pro tip: Go early to claim your favorite table, especially on rainy evenings or weekends—it gets busy fast when the weather turns!

Family Outing Idea: Sunday in the Park Concert Series

Where: Town Common, Greenville NC
Cost: Free

Let the kids run wild on the lawn while you kick back with live music and local eats. The Sunday in the Park series is a Greenville favorite, blending summer breezes, scenic river views, and free outdoor concerts that appeal to all ages. With food vendors on-site and plenty of space to spread out, it’s an easy, low-cost way to end your weekend on a high note.
Pro tip: Bring lawn chairs or a picnic blanket, and arrive a little early to claim a shady spot near the stage.

Reader Spotlight: Wildwood Park

Looking for a spot with something for everyone? Barbara J recommends Wildwood Park—perfect for picnics, playtime, and peaceful views.

Barbara J loves Wildwood Park and for good reason! Whether you’re packing a picnic, bringing the kids to play, or looking to bike the trails, this spot has it all. Don’t miss the 1.5-mile loop around the lake or the dock where you can launch your boat—or rent one if you don’t have your own. A must-visit for your next outdoor adventure!
